Job Description

This role will play a pivotal part in executing and evolving the companys talent acquisition strategies to support the companys ambitious growth for 2025.



Job description

Our client is one of New Englands leading construction companies specializing in large complex projects. This individual will be responsible for managing recruiting activities for multiple offices across the country.

  • Responsibilities:
    Manages the development implementation and evaluation of recruiting practices and procedures and supervises and coordinates recruiting and staffing activities.

    Develops and establishes recruiting strategies processes tactics procedures while managing recruitment services for the Company.

    Regularly reviews and manages requisition distribution to optimize resources.

    Addresses all aging requisitions.

    Manages and maintains applicant tracking system(ATS).

    Manages departmental reporting on position status and recruitment issues.

    Collaborates with Communications for social media posting and advertising to ensure proper context and branding guidelines are being followed.

    Manages vendor relationships (agency/headhunter secondary tools etc.) and monitors and reports on utilization costvalue and other KPIs.

    Builds and maintains strong relationships with key stakeholders (both internal and external).

    Manages departmental budget reviewing activities expenses and invoices.

    Travels approximately 10%(Regional).

    Manages employees by mentoring coaching providing feedback and assessing performance.

    Evaluates employees performance.

    Performs other duties as assigned.

    Qualifications
    :

    Education: Bachelors Degree

    8 years of experience

    Full cycle recruitment experience required ideally in the commercial construction industry
